发表评论取消回复
相关阅读
相关 并发控制难题:多线程环境下的数据一致性
在多线程环境下,数据一致性是一个非常关键且具有挑战性的难题。主要体现在以下几个方面: 1. **竞态条件**:多个线程同时访问和修改共享资源,可能会导致预期结果的不一致。
相关 并发控制难题:多线程环境下数据一致性
在多线程环境下,数据一致性是一个非常重要的但也是极具挑战性的并发控制难题。 主要问题包括: 1. **死锁**:多个线程互相等待对方释放资源导致的僵局。 2. **读写不
相关 并发问题:多线程环境下数据一致性案例
在多线程环境下,数据一致性是一个常见的并发挑战。以下是一个经典的数据一致性的案例——银行的转账系统。 1. 系统描述: 银行有一个转账系统,允许用户从一个账户向另一个账
相关 并发控制不当:多线程环境下的数据一致性问题
并发控制不当确实是多线程环境下常见的数据一致性问题。具体表现有以下几点: 1. **死锁**:多个线程互相等待对方释放资源,导致无法继续执行。 2. **数据不一致(竞态条
相关 并发控制难题:多线程环境下数据一致性案例
在多线程环境中,数据一致性的挑战主要体现在以下几种常见场景: 1. **共享内存**: - 线程A写入一个变量v,但未同步操作。 - 同时线程B读取了v,并进行了
相关 并发控制不当:多线程环境下数据竞争
在多线程环境中,并发控制不当往往会导致数据竞争问题。具体表现为: 1. 同一资源的多个线程同时访问。 2. 由于锁机制、条件变量或其他同步手段使用不正确,导致某个时刻只有一个
相关 并发控制难题:多线程环境下数据一致性问题
在多线程环境下,数据一致性问题是并发控制的重要挑战。具体表现有以下几点: 1. **共享资源冲突**:多个线程同时访问和修改同一个变量,可能导致数据不一致。 2. **无锁
相关 并发控制难题:Java多线程环境下数据一致性保证
在Java多线程环境中,确保数据一致性是一项复杂的挑战。主要的解决策略有以下几种: 1. **锁(Synchronization)**: - `synchronized
相关 并发控制不当:Java多线程环境下的数据一致性问题
在Java的多线程环境下,如果并发控制不当,确实会出现数据一致性的问题。以下是一些常见的场景: 1. **锁竞争**:多个线程同时获取同一把锁,可能导致部分线程无法正常执行,
相关 并发控制不当:多线程环境下的Java问题示例
在多线程环境下,如果并发控制不当,可能会导致数据不一致、死锁等问题。下面我们将以Java为例,展示这些问题的实例。 1. 数据不一致(线程安全问题) ```java pub
还没有评论,来说两句吧...